Many large asbestos companies were unable or unwilling to pay their liability for the harm caused by the use of their products. They filed for bankruptcy, and were then ordered by the courts to establish trust funds to pay the victims of their asbestos exposure. The trust funds have a value of more than $30 billion, and a mesothelioma lawyer can assist a client to submit an application for compensation.

Mesothelioma suits typically compensate victims for past and current medical expenses, lost wages and companionship along with pain and suffering, among other losses. Compensation can be sought through a personal injury lawsuit that is filed by someone who has been diagnosed with mesothelioma or through a wrongful death lawsuit that is filed by the immediate family members of a deceased victim.
The wrongful death lawsuits may be settled outside of court or, as in other civil cases, a jury verdict can be made. These types of claims have led to substantial compensation for many victims.
The average settlement in mesothelioma cases is around $1 million. Some lawsuits are settled prior to trial, resulting in greater payouts. Compensation from a mesothelioma settlement could also allow eligible people to qualify for social security benefits and veterans' benefits, as well as assist them with accessing trust funds that were set up by bankrupt companies that have knowingly exposed their employees to asbestos.

If a loved one passes away from mesothelioma the immediate family members can file a lawsuit against asbestos-related companies. This type of lawsuit allows the victim to recover compensation for the past and future medical expenses, lost income, and discomfort and pain.
Since a large number of asbestos companies responsible for mesothelioma have gone bankrupt and are now insolvent, you can sue the companies in bankruptcy court. A mesothelioma attorney can help to file a bankruptcy lawsuit and ensure it gets the attention it deserves. The bankruptcy trust will distribute funds according to the claim once it is filed. The mesothelioma lawyer you choose should have prior experience in pursuing asbestos claims using the bankruptcy system.
